The thing most none engine builders cant see is what is going on at the very top at super one. The head volume and squish on a rotax is quite a way out when standard (new). Now if your a big team/ engine builder you could run you engine up on castor for a long period to coke the head, then remove the head and profile the coke on a lathe to get exact minimum squish and on the limit head volume. Then after every meeting take head off and check squish and head volume is still within rotax limits - this is easy if you have a sealership. Most customers and average joes cannot break the wire and play this game. Its amazing at how many club event the scrutineers only check squish and yet the head volume could be so illegal. Anybody that raced tkm will know/ feel the difference of a fully coked head.
